NOTICE OF INTENT TO CONTRACT WITH A SINGLE SOURCE: The Federal Aviation Administration intends to award a single source contract to Aviat U.S.,Inc, Austin, Texas for purchase of two (2) IP-ready microwave radios with site specific transmit and receive frequencies based on current microwave radio configurations at D/10DFW complex for Field Test operations and verification in support of Brand New Air Traffic Control Systems (BNATCS) IP Microwave Solution.

In accordance with the FAA Acquisition Management System, AMS 3.2.2.4, the purpose of this announcement is to inform industry of the basis of the FAA’s decision to contract with a selected source when it is determined to be in the best interest of the FAA. This procurement is considered to be single-sourced to Aviat U.S.,Inc based on the following 5 categories: BAA Compliance, All Indoor Unit, IP Capability, Compatibility with existing FAA Power Systems, Compatibility with existing FAA Channel Banks. The impact of not having an IP ready solution for LDRCL would be failure for remaining FAA Owned Microwave Systems links in the NAS. This requirement will be awarded to Aviat U.S. Inc and is not available for full and open competition.
